Chepping View Primary Academy is seeking to appoint a motivated and enthusiastic PPA cover Teacher. This role is suitable for either an unqualified teacher or a qualified teacher.
You will have excellent teamwork and communication skills, boundless patience, resilience and the ability and enthusiasm to make a difference.
The post holder will carry out teaching commitments across EYFS, KS1& KS2 and will contribute to Chepping View Primary Academy’s vision to work collaboratively to educate and nurture our community.

Chepping View Primary Academy is a combined primary academy, National Support School and National Behaviour Hub. We are also the founding school of Inspiring Futures Partnership Trust, a small MAT in Buckinghamshire, comprising of 3 schools.
